A final agreement is expected to be signed this Friday in Switzerland. Here's what we know so far:
- The ceasefire has been extended to 60 days.
- The Strait of Hormuz is gradually reopening: no more mines and tolls.
- The US will lift its naval blockade imposed in April on ships moving in and out of Iranian ports.
- The minimum commitment expected on Iran's nuclear programme seems to be 'for all the enriched uranium to be down-blended on site, under the supervision of the International Atomic Energy Agency'. There are concerns that the War will end before an agreement on this topic is reached.
- Pakistan and Qatar have confirmed they'll continue to contribute in favour of the stabilisation and peace in the region. It is unclear what this will translate to in the Israel-Lebanon conflict.
- A regime change is not under discussion. An international mobilisation of funds is expected to support the country's reconstruction and the recovery of the Iranian people.
